Nuance Analysis & Word Contrasts

The term 'strip' implies a specific dimensional quality: length significantly exceeding width. Unlike 'band,' which often suggests a decorative or functional encircling, 'strip' is purely descriptive of shape. It is preferred when emphasizing the isolation of a small, elongated portion from a larger whole, often implying a clean or deliberate separation.

strip vs band

A strip is defined by its shape and isolation, whereas a band often implies a functional purpose, such as binding, encircling, or marking a specific area.

strip vs sliver

A strip is neutral regarding thickness, while a sliver specifically denotes a thin, often sharp or fragile piece broken off from a larger object.
